Hybrid Linked Mode

Hybrid Linked Mode links your
VMware Cloud on Dell EMC
vCenter Server instance with an on-premises
vCenter
Single Sign-On domain. You can configure the Hybrid Linked Mode between VMware Cloud on Dell EMC SDDC and on-premises SDDC either directly or through
vCenter
Cloud Gateway to manage both the SDDCs in a single user interface. This can also be used to support VM migration across these SDDCs.
Before you can use Hybrid Linked Mode with
VMware Cloud on Dell EMC
, you must configure your on-premises vCenter to enable single sign-on. For more information, see vSphere Authentication with vCenter Single Sign-On.
If you link your cloud vCenter Server to a domain that contains multiple vCenter Server instances linked using Enhanced Linked Mode, all those instances are linked to your
VMware Cloud on Dell EMC
SDDC.
Using Hybrid Linked Mode, you can:
  • View and manage the inventories of both your on-premises and
    VMware Cloud on Dell EMC
    SDDC from a single
    vSphere
    Client interface, accessed using Single Sign On (SSO) credentials.
  • Migrate workloads between your on-premises data center and
    VMware Cloud on Dell EMC
    SDDC.
  • Share tags and tag categories from your vCenter Server instance to your
    VMware Cloud on Dell EMC
    SDDC.
Hybrid Linked Mode supports on-premises vCenter Server systems running 6.7 and later with either embedded or external Platform Services Controller (both Windows and vCenter Server Appliance). vCenter Server systems with external Platform Services Controller instances linked in Enhanced Linked Mode are also supported up to the scale limits documented in vSphere 6.7 Configuration Maximums.
You have two options for configuring Hybrid Linked Mode. You can use only one of these options at a time.
  • You can install the vCenter Cloud Gateway Appliance and use it to link from your on-premises data center to the
    VMware Cloud on Dell EMC
    SDDC. In this case, SSO users and groups are mapped from your on-premises environment to the SDDC and you do not need to add an identity source to the SDDC LDAP domain.
  • You can link your
    VMware Cloud on Dell EMC
    to your on-premises vCenter Server. In this case, you must add an identity source to the SDDC LDAP domain.
